Fishbike explains the math above; it really is that simple. Send it back! You can't use Ohm's Law to relate battery voltage and computer current draw for various battery voltages. Ohm's Law applies to linear resistances, not to the switching power supplies you find between the battery and the rest of your computer's guts.

The output of a switching power supply will be a set of nice constant voltages typically 5V, 3. Those components, in turn, will draw as much current from the switching supply as they need from instant to instant. If you multiply the current being drawn from each of the switching supply's outputs by the voltage of that output, you get the total power being supplied on that output.

If a switching supply needs to draw 50 watts from a laptop battery, it will draw as much current as it needs to do in order to make that current in amps, multiplied by the battery's terminal voltage in volts, equal So in fact running your laptop off a lower-voltage battery will make it draw more current from that battery than it would from a higher-voltage one, not less.

The mAh rating is not the only thing that matters, and you should be concerned that you may not have understood what you were ordering. So even assuming your laptop will actually work on the lower voltage pack not necessarily a given; its switching supply might not be designed to cope with an input voltage that low it will certainly not run for as long.

Specifically, this claim from the vendor MAh Milliamperes represents the amount of stored energy in your battery. If they could sell you a MAh battery the size of a laptop pack, you should be designing the next generation of electric cars around it. To convert mAh to mWh, you need to multiply by voltage.

This is true only if the batteries being compared have the same voltage rating. If it's the same voltage rating as the original, this is true. If it's a lower voltage rating than the original, you need to a be sure that your laptop will actually work at that voltage and b multiply each pack's mAh rating by its voltage rating to generate mWh numbers that you can then use to compare likely runtimes.
